As I mentioned in my review of Ancient Scriptures, while that one is good, Warlust kind of leaves it in the dust. Immediately the better production is noticeable and it really helps blast those energetic songs out of the speakers. The songwriting has improved, the band sounds tighter, and I don't know if I'm imagining things, but it really sounds like they pay homage to their multiple influences with short passages that make you go, "hey, this sounds like..." Sometimes I think I'm in War and Pain-era Voïvod, sometimes I think Exodus is about to pop in for a visit and the title track has that 80s Razor vibe that just kills. Cool stuff. Black Mass have put together a nicely varied album with Warlust and it's simply a fun, headbang-inducing listen. I could have done without "Interlude" and the spoken passages that I found really break the mood, but they're such a tiny portion of the album that they're relatively easy to overlook. The band have certainly set the bar higher for themselves. |
